>>Can anyone give me a list of reasons why I might want to simulate 
>>static pages?
> 
> 
> Much better Google indexing -- much more visitors to your site.
> 
> Urls are easier to remember -- looks more atractive (compare
> "http://mydomain.com/index.php?id=25843" with
> "http://mydomain.com/Cheapest_auto_parts.25843.html").
> 
> Dmitry.

+1

Google indexing is the most interesting reason.

Plus, the fact that it is Typo3 core function and not an external 
extension. It works fine, it's fast and, for my point of view, the best 
advantage is that it's MySQL free-consuming (no intermediate table as it 
is in the my RealURL extension, if i remember well).
